I was at B&N yesterday and had a chance to look at the new Nook Touch. In my opinion, t is a much improved device from the original Nook. I'm not in the market as I'm pretty happy with my iPad and iPhone as readers, but if I were I would be interested in it. Much clearer screen, long battery life, the touch screen makes operating it easier. The only downside is that I'm a big fan of the Kindle apps on my other devices. I will be glad when all readers share the same software.
